Shōta Kimura ( Japanese 木村 勝 太 Kimura Shōta ; born October 17, 1988 in Tokyo Prefecture ) is a Japanese football player .
Career
Kimura learned to play soccer in the youth team of Yokohama F. Marinos . He signed his first contract with Ventforet Kofu in 2007 . The club played in the highest league in the country, the J1 League . At the end of the 2007 season, the club was relegated to the J2 League . For the club he completed 20 league games. In 2009 he moved to Matsumoto Yamaga FC . In 2012 he moved to the second division club Kataller Toyama . For the club he completed 95 league games. In 2015 he moved to third division club Grulla Morioka . For the club he completed 26 league games. At the end of 2015, he ended his career as a football player.
